In today's data-driven world, organizations are generating and collecting vast amounts of data from various sources, including social media, sensors, applications, and databases. However, this data is often siloed, making it difficult to access, analyze, and gain valuable insights. Data integration has become a critical process that enables businesses to combine data from multiple sources, providing a unified view of their operations, customers, and market trends.
